Convoy Airmen protect supply lines in Iraq
BALAD AIR BASE, Iraq -- Staff Sgt. Chris Hargis and Senior Airman Clint Berger break down a machine gun and check it to ensure it is ready before the next convoy. Their unit provides convoy protection to civilian contractors and Army units delivering supplies throughout the area of responsibility. They are assigned to the 732nd Expeditionary Mission Support Group's Detachment 2632. (U.S. Air Force photo by Staff Sgt. Lindsey Maurice)
